GroupDocs.Watermark for Java API

Java Excel Управление водяными знаками

Используйте GroupDocs.Watermark for Java для эффективного и точного удаления или редактирования водяных знаков в электронных таблицах Excel.

Очистите документы Excel от водяных знаков с помощью Java.

GroupDocs.Watermark позволяет легко удалять из деловых документов ранее добавленные водяные знаки. Расширьте возможности своего приложения Java, установив нашу библиотеку и сделав это за несколько простых шагов:

  1. Прежде всего создайте экземпляр основного класса с именем Watermarker с помощью документа Excel. Наш API поддерживает передачу документа для обработки как поток или локальный путь.
  2. Используйте SearchCriteria, чтобы ограничить набор обрабатываемых водяных знаков. В качестве параметра поиска можно использовать изображение, а также функции текста или форматирования. Тогда вы укажете более конкретные параметры поиска и получите более точный результат.
  3. Обработать список водяных знаков документов, полученных в результате поиска. Очистите документ.
  4. После очистки документа сохраните результат в виде локального файла или потока байтов.

// Очистить текстовый водяной знак в документе Excel

// Создайте экземпляр Watermarker с помощью документа Excel.
Watermarker watermarker = new Watermarker("input.xslx");

// Удалить конкретный водяной знак
PossibleWatermarkCollection possibleWatermarks = watermarker.search();
possibleWatermarks.removeAt(0);

// Сохранить обработанный файл
watermarker.save("output.xslx");
<dependencies> <dependency> <groupId>com.groupdocs</groupId> <artifactId>groupdocs-watermark</artifactId> <version>24.8</version> </dependency> </dependencies> <repositories> <repository> <id>repository.groupdocs.com</id> <name>GroupDocs Repository</name> <url>https://repository.groupdocs.com/repo/</url> </repository> </repositories>
нажмите, чтобы скопировать
скопировал
Больше примеров Документация

Эффективное удаление водяных знаков с помощью API Java

Изучите надежные возможности нашего API Java по удалению или очистке водяных знаков из различных типов документов, включая PDF и файлы Office. Идеально подходит для разработчиков, которые хотят сохранить четкие визуальные эффекты и защитить целостность документов.

Очистить водяной знак

Точное удаление водяных знаков

Используйте наш API Java для точного поиска и удаления водяных знаков без нарушения исходного макета документа. Идеально подходит для конфиденциальных или официальных документов, где ясность и точность имеют первостепенное значение.

Пакетное удаление водяных знаков

Повысьте эффективность обработки документов, удалив водяные знаки из нескольких файлов одновременно. Наш API поддерживает пакетные операции, экономя время и ресурсы при выполнении крупномасштабных задач.

Отредактируйте элементы водяных знаков

Наши передовые инструменты редактирования позволяют выборочно редактировать компоненты водяных знаков, обеспечивая гибкость в управлении презентациями документов и обеспечивая безопасность контента.

PDF водяной знак с открытым текстом

В этом примере показано, как найти и удалить все аннотации, содержащие текст определенного форматирования, из документа PDF.

Java


//  Загрузить документ PDF
PdfLoadOptions loadOptions = new PdfLoadOptions();
Watermarker watermarker = new Watermarker("source.pdf", loadOptions);

//  Получите содержимое документа
PdfContent pdfContent = watermarker.getContent(PdfContent.class);

//  Прозрачные текстовые водяные знаки с определенным шрифтом
for (PdfPage page : pdfContent.getPages()){
    for (int i = page.getAnnotations().getCount() - 1; i >= 0; i--){
        for (FormattedTextFragment fragment : page.getAnnotations().get_Item(i).getFormattedTextFragments()){
            if (fragment.getFont().getFamilyName() == "Verdana"){
                page.getAnnotations().removeAt(i);
                break;
            }
        }
    }
}

//  Сохраните документ
watermarker.save("result.pdf");
watermarker.close();

библиотека GroupDocs.Watermark for Java

С помощью библиотеки GroupDocs.Watermark for Java разработчики могут легко управлять водяными знаками в файлах Excel. Этот инструмент поддерживает такие операции, как удаление, настройка и поиск текстовых и графических водяных знаков. Идеально подходит для приложений, требующих четкого визуального представления данных без ущерба для безопасности или структуры документа.
Узнайте больше
About illustration

Готовы начать?

Загрузите GroupDocs.Watermark бесплатно или получите пробную лицензию для полного доступа!

Полезные ресурсы

Изучите документацию, примеры кода и раздел поддержки, чтобы улучшить ваш опыт.

Управление водяными знаками Excel в Java

Узнайте, как API Excel упрощает удаление водяных знаков из Excel документов, сохраняя целостность и четкость файлов.

Советы по временной лицензии

1
Зарегистрируйтесь, используя ваш рабочий e-mail адрес. Бесплатные почтовые сервисы запрещены.
2
Используйте кнопку Получить временную лицензию на втором шаге.
 Русский